Description

This inviting second-floor apartment combines space, natural light, and an appealing layout, offering two well-sized bedrooms and the benefit of a share of freehold. A private balcony provides a welcome spot to relax in the open air, while the location places you just moments from the vibrant heart of Highams Park, with its mix of shops, cafés, and local amenities. Epping Forest is within a short stroll, offering miles of woodland walks and green open space to explore. Spanning around 718 square feet, the property also includes a private garage, adding both convenience and valuable additional storage or secure parking.

Nestled within a well-connected corner of East London, the area offers a lively yet welcoming atmosphere with a strong sense of community. A short stroll brings you to Highams Park’s bustling high street, home to a variety of independent shops, cafés, and everyday conveniences. For coffee and brunch, Biba & Wren serves thoughtfully prepared dishes in stylish surroundings, while The Stag & Lantern provides a warm setting for drinks with friends. The Royal Oak offers a traditional pub experience with hearty food and a friendly buzz. Green space is plentiful, with Highams Park Lake and the vast expanse of Epping Forest nearby, ideal for woodland walks and peaceful moments.

WHAT ELSE?
Highams Park Station is around a five-minute walk, providing swift links into the city. The area is also well served by a network of bus routes, connecting to nearby neighbourhoods such as Walthamstow, Chingford, and Woodford, as well as further afield. Whether travelling for work or leisure, the excellent transport options make it easy to enjoy both the buzz of London life and the green spaces close to home.
